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of polymerization production, and particularly to a high-efficiency cooling device for the polymerization process of nylon 6 and its working method. Background Technology

[0002] In the production of nylon 6 polymer chips, the heating and cooling temperatures in the polymerization process directly affect the polymerization reaction, chemical equilibrium, molecular weight distribution, viscosity, and other process quality of caprolactam, thus affecting the quality of the chips. Generally, a mixture of biphenyl and diphenyl ether at around 200 degrees Celsius is used as the heating and cooling medium (265±10℃ is the heating temperature, and 233±5℃ is the cooling temperature; the mixture of biphenyl and diphenyl ether is also called the heat medium, and will be referred to as the heat medium in the following text). Since the condensation polymerization reaction in the polymerization process generates a large amount of heat, this heat will cause the temperature of the 233±5℃ cooling heat medium to rise rapidly. The heat medium will lose its cooling effect, causing the polymerization temperature to be too high or unstable. In this case, the polymerization reaction system will be disrupted, and the quality of the chips will fluctuate.

[0003] Currently, caprolactam at around 80℃ is used as the cooling medium in the polymerization process. However, the flow rate or temperature of caprolactam can fluctuate, which affects the cooling process temperature and the polymerization reaction temperature. In addition, when the workshop equipment is maintained, the supply of caprolactam is sometimes stopped. This prevents the heat exchange between the cooling medium and caprolactam from being completed normally, causing fluctuations in both the cooling medium temperature and the polymerization reaction temperature. Consequently, the polymerization reaction system becomes unstable, resulting in a decrease in the quality of the chips and a reduction in the factory's production efficiency. Summary of the Invention

[0004] In view of the above-mentioned shortcomings of the prior art, the purpose of the invention is to provide a high-efficiency cooling device for the polymerization process of nylon 6 and its working method. In addition to using caprolactam as the heat-absorbing medium, the device also uses a low-temperature heat medium of 80°C and a room-temperature cold air as the cooling medium, which can stabilize the heat medium and the constant temperature of polymerization, effectively maintain the polymerization reaction system, and ensure and improve the quality of the chips.

[0005] The technical solution of the invention is as follows:

[0006] A high-efficiency cooling device for nylon 6 polymerization process is characterized by comprising a polymerization tower and a tubular cooler located in the upper part of the polymerization tower. The heat medium outlet of the tubular cooler is connected to a heat medium pipe, which is sequentially connected to a three-way control valve, a first branch, and a second branch. The first branch is connected to a first heat exchanger using caprolactam as the cooling medium, and the second branch is sequentially connected to an air cooler and a heat exchanger using a low-temperature heat medium. The outlet of the first heat exchanger and the second branch merge before the inlet of the air cooler. The outlet of the heat exchanger is sequentially connected to a filter, a heat medium pump, and a heater, and the outlet of the heater is connected to the heat medium inlet of the tubular cooler. A first temperature gauge is installed on the caprolactam outlet pipe of the first heat exchanger, and the first temperature gauge is signal-interlocked with the three-way control valve. A second temperature gauge is installed on the outlet pipe of the heater, and the second temperature gauge is signal-interlocked with the fan of the air cooler and the low-temperature heat medium control valve of the heat exchanger.

[0007] Preferably, the heat transfer pipes inside the air cooler and heat transfer heat exchanger adopt a serpentine structure to increase the heat exchange area.

[0008] Preferably, a first bypass manual valve is connected in parallel to both ends of the above-mentioned three-way control valve, and a second bypass manual valve is connected in parallel to both ends of the low-temperature heat medium control valve, for bypassing the corresponding control valve during maintenance.

[0009] Preferably, a cooler is connected to the low-temperature heat medium outlet pipe of the heat exchanger. The cooler is equipped with a cooling water inlet pipe and a cooling water outlet pipe to cool the low-temperature heat medium after heat exchange to the process temperature for recycling.

[0010] Preferably, the temperature of the caprolactam is 80±5℃, the temperature of the low-temperature heat medium is 80±5℃, and the air cooler uses room temperature cold air as the cooling medium.

[0011] Preferably, the second thermometer is set with a process temperature value of 233±5℃, a high temperature alarm value, and an ultra-high temperature alarm value; when the second thermometer reaches the high temperature alarm value, the fan is triggered to start; when the second thermometer reaches the ultra-high temperature alarm value, the low temperature heat transfer medium control valve is triggered to open; when the temperature of the second thermometer drops back to the process temperature value, the fan stops running and the low temperature heat transfer medium control valve closes.

[0012] Preferably, the heat medium inlet pipe of the air cooler is connected to a heat medium replenishment pipe and a valve for replenishing heat medium to the heat medium circulation pipeline.

[0013] Preferably, the heater is connected to a high-temperature heat transfer medium pipe and a heat replenishment control valve. The heat replenishment control valve is interlocked with the signal of the second temperature gauge. When the temperature of the circulating heat transfer medium is lower than the process value, the high-temperature heat transfer medium is heated by the heater.

[0014] Preferably, the first branch and the second branch can operate independently. When the first heat exchanger stops supplying caprolactam, the second branch starts cooling the heat medium. The heat medium is a mixture of biphenyl and diphenyl ether. The tubular cooler is used to transfer the heat of polymerization reaction in the polymerization tower to the heat medium. The temperature of the heat medium in the high-temperature heat medium pipe of the heater is 330±5℃.

[0015] The working method of the efficient nylon 6 polymerization process cooling device of the present invention includes the following steps:

[0016] (1) Start-up of heat medium circulation: Fill the heat medium circulation pipeline with heat medium through the heat medium replenishment pipe, open the manual valves of each branch, and start the heat medium pump to make the heat medium circulate between the tube cooler of the polymerization tower, the first heat exchanger, the air cooler, the heat medium heat exchanger, the filter and the heater;

[0017] (2) Caprolactam cooling control: Caprolactam at 80±5℃ is introduced into the first heat exchanger. The heat medium is distributed to the first heat exchanger through the three-way control valve. The outlet temperature of caprolactam is detected by the first temperature gauge. The opening of the three-way regulating valve is interlocked to allow the heat medium to exchange heat with caprolactam in the first heat exchanger.

[0018] (3) Intelligent triggering of air cooling and heat exchange of heat medium: The heat medium temperature at the heater outlet is detected by the second temperature gauge. When the temperature reaches the high temperature alarm value of 233±5℃, the fan of the air cooler is started to cool the heat medium. When the temperature reaches the ultra-high temperature alarm value, the low temperature heat medium control valve is opened to introduce the low temperature heat medium of 80±5℃ into the heat medium heat exchanger for secondary cooling. After heat exchange, the low temperature heat medium enters the jacket cooler to be cooled to the process temperature and is recycled.

[0019] (4) Emergency switching in case of failure: When the supply of caprolactam is interrupted, the three-way control valve automatically switches to the fully open second branch state, and the air cooler and heat exchanger of the heat medium start automatically according to the detection value of the second temperature gauge to maintain the stable temperature of the circulating heat medium.

[0020] (5) Dynamic compensation of heat medium temperature: When the second temperature gauge detects that the temperature of the circulating heat medium is lower than the process value, the heater’s heat replenishment control valve is automatically opened to introduce a high-temperature heat medium of 330±5℃ for heating, ensuring that the temperature of the circulating heat medium is constant within the process range.

[0021] Significant advantages of this invention:

[0022] 1. Using 80℃ low-temperature heat medium and room-temperature cold air as cooling medium, the low-temperature heat medium is used in a closed loop, which not only produces no waste liquid, waste gas, or waste material, but also automatically maintains a constant circulating heat medium and polymerization temperature, improving production efficiency. In particular, when the supply of caprolactam stops and the first heat exchanger becomes ineffective, the cooling treatment of the circulating heat medium will not be affected, and the polymerization reaction and chemical equilibrium will not fluctuate. The polymerization production can continue to proceed steadily, and the quality of the chips is guaranteed. It is a very efficient and stable polymerization cooling process.

[0023] 2. Similarly, if another heat exchanger malfunctions or needs to be shut down for maintenance, it will not affect the cooling of the circulating heat medium and the polymerization production.

[0024] 3. After absorbing heat, caprolactam is heated from 80°C to about 160°C before entering the polymerization process. This is equivalent to preheating it before it enters the polymerization tower, which not only saves energy consumption of the heat transfer medium, but also greatly improves the polymerization reaction time and efficiency of caprolactam. Attached Figure Description

[0025] Figure 1 This is a schematic diagram illustrating the working principle of the present invention. Detailed Implementation

[0026] The invention will now be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ings.

[0027] As shown in the figure, the upper part of the polymerization tower 1 is equipped with a shell-and-tube cooler 01 that uses a heat medium as the heat exchange (cooling) medium. The heat medium outlet end of the shell-and-tube cooler 01 is connected to a heat medium pipe 11. The heat medium pipe 11 is connected to a three-way control valve 12. The front and rear ends of the three-way control valve 12 are connected to manual valves 13 and 14, respectively. The front and rear ends of manual valves 13 and 14 are connected in parallel to a first bypass manual valve 15. The first bypass manual valve 15 is also a bypass valve of the three-way control valve 12 (the first bypass manual valve 15 is used when the three-way control valve 12 is under maintenance). The outlet end of the manual valve 14 (i.e., the first branch) is connected to the first heat exchanger 5. The first heat exchanger 5 is connected to a caprolactam pipe 6. A first thermometer 24 is installed on the outlet pipe of the caprolactam pipe 6 (the heat medium pipe and the caprolactam pipe in the first heat exchanger 5 are independent heat conduction pipes). The first thermometer 24 is signal-interlocked with the three-way control valve 12.

[0028] As shown in the figure, the other outlet end (i.e., the second branch) of the three-way control valve 12 is connected to the manual valve 16. The outlet pipe of the manual valve 16 is connected to the outlet pipe of the first heat exchanger 5, and then to the air cooler 7 (i.e., the outlet of the first heat exchanger 5 and the second branch merge before the inlet of the air cooler 7). The inlet pipe of the air cooler 7 is connected to the heat medium replenishment pipe 32 and the valve 31. The air cooler 7 is connected to the fan 8 and the air pipe 26. The heat medium pipe inside the air cooler 7 is designed in a serpentine shape (the air cooler 7 is also a heat exchanger, and the heat medium pipe and the air pipe inside the air cooler 7 are independent heat-conducting pipes) to increase the heat exchange area. The outlet end of the air cooler 7 is connected to the heat medium heat exchanger 9. The internal heat medium pipes are also designed in a serpentine shape to increase the heat exchange area; the outlet end of the heat medium heat exchanger 9 is connected to a manual valve 17, which is connected to a filter 3. The outlet end of the filter 3 is connected to a manual valve 18, which is connected to a heat medium pump 2. A manual valve 19 is installed at the outlet end of the heat medium pump 2. The outlet pipe of the manual valve 19 is connected to a heater 4 (which is also a heat exchanger). The outlet pipe of the heater 4 is connected to the inlet end of the tubular cooler in the upper part of the polymerization tower 1. A high-temperature heat medium pipe 30 and a heat replenishment control valve 29 are installed on the heater 4 to heat the circulating heat medium in the heat medium pipe 11 (the heat medium pipe in the heater 4 and the pipe through which the high-temperature heat medium flows are independent heat-conducting pipes).

[0029] As shown in the figure, a low-temperature heat medium inlet pipe 33 and an outlet pipe 34 are installed on the heat medium heat exchanger 9. A cooler 10 using cooling water as the cooling medium is installed on the low-temperature heat medium outlet pipe 34. A cooling water inlet pipe 27 and a cooling water outlet pipe 28 are installed on the cooler 10. A low-temperature heat medium control valve 20 is installed on the low-temperature heat medium inlet pipe 33. The front and rear ends of the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20 are connected to manual valves 21 and 22, respectively. The front and rear ends of manual valves 21 and 22 are connected in parallel to a second bypass manual valve 23, which serves as a bypass valve for the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20.

[0030] As shown in the figure, a second thermometer 25 is installed on the outlet pipe of heater 4. The second thermometer 25 is interlocked with the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20, the fan 8, and the heat replenishment control valve 29.

[0031] In this application, the signal interlocking refers to a system consisting of three parts: a detection unit (sensor), a control unit (logic controller), and an execution unit (valve / fan, etc.). The detection unit (such as the first temperature gauge 24 and the second temperature gauge 25) collects the temperature data of the heat medium or caprolactam in real time. The control unit compares the detected value with the preset process threshold to determine whether an action needs to be triggered. The execution unit (such as the three-way control valve 12, the fan 8, and the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20) automatically completes switching, adjustment, and other operations according to the control signal.

[0032] The first thermometer 24 and the second thermometer 25 can be resistance temperature detectors (models can be WEST P8100 series or Omron E5CC series, measuring range: -200~600℃, supporting 4-20mA analog signals or Modbus RTU digital signals, which can be directly connected to a PLC to achieve interlocking control). The control unit (PLC) can be a Siemens S7-1200 series, model: CPU1214C + SM 1231 AI module + SM 1223 DI / DO module, supporting 8 analog inputs and 16 digital outputs (controlling three-way control valves, fans, etc.).

[0033] Operating instructions for the above cooling device:

[0034] 1. Fill the circulating heat medium pipe 11 with sufficient heat medium through the heat medium replenishment pipe 32 and valve 31, open manual valves 13, 14, 16, 17 and 18, start the heat medium pump 2, open manual valve 19, and the heat medium in the heat medium pipe 11 will begin to circulate.

[0035] Caprolactam (temperature 80±5℃) is supplied to the tube side of the first heat exchanger 5 through caprolactam tube 6. The heat medium enters the shell side of the first heat exchanger 5, and the process temperature value of the first temperature gauge 24 is set (generally 160±10℃). The first temperature gauge 24 sends a signal to the three-way control valve 12. At this time, the three-way control valve 12 automatically opens according to the process temperature value of the first temperature gauge 24 and supplies equal or different amounts of heat medium to the first heat exchanger 5 and the manual valve 16. At this time, the caprolactam in the tube side of the first heat exchanger 5 will exchange excess heat in the circulating heat medium, causing the temperature of the circulating heat medium to drop below the temperature of the tube cooler at the top of the polymerization tower 1.

[0036] 2. After the heat medium merges at the first heat exchanger 5 and the manual valve 16, it enters the air cooler 7 and the heat medium heat exchanger 9, then returns to the heat medium pump 2 through the filter 3, and then returns to the shell and tube cooler at the top of the polymerization tower 1 through the heat medium pump 2.

[0037] 3. Set the process temperature value (generally 233±5℃) and high (238℃±2℃) and ultra-high (242℃±2℃) temperature alarm values ​​for the second temperature gauge 25. Based on the process temperature value of the second temperature gauge 25, the supplementary heat control valve 29 automatically opens or closes. The temperature of the heat medium in the high-temperature heat medium pipe 30 is generally 330±5℃. If the process temperature of the second temperature gauge 25 is too high and reaches the alarm value, a signal is sent to the fan 8, which automatically starts to cool the heat medium in the serpentine tube of the air cooler 7. When the process temperature of the second temperature gauge 25 is too high and reaches the ultra-high temperature alarm value, a signal is sent to the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20 (temperature 80±5℃), causing it to automatically open and further cool the heat medium in the serpentine tube of the heat medium heat exchanger 9. After heat exchange, the temperature of the low-temperature heat medium will be higher than the process value. After heat exchange with the cooling water of the double-channel cooler 10, it will return to the process value and return to the low-temperature heat medium system. When the high and ultra-high temperature alarm values ​​of the second temperature gauge 25 are cleared, the second temperature gauge 25 sends a signal to the low-temperature heat medium control valve 20 to make it automatically close. When the second temperature gauge 25 reaches the process temperature value, it sends a signal to the fan 8, and the fan 8 automatically stops running.

[0038] 4. If the supply of caprolactam to the tube side of the first heat exchanger 5 is stopped due to workshop maintenance or other reasons, the heat exchange between the circulating heat medium and caprolactam will stop. At this time, the temperature of the circulating heat medium coming out of the shell and tube cooler in the upper part of the polymerization tower 1 will be abnormally high. Then the operation in step 3 above will automatically take effect to make the temperature of the circulating heat medium (second temperature gauge 25) reach the process temperature value.
